Kazakhstan Customs Wins the 2020 WCO Photo Competition

Publish Date: 
20 Jul 2020

On 10 July the World Customs Organization (WCO) announced that a photo submitted by Kazakhstan Customs, as part of its annual Photo Competition, had been voted as the winner of the competition 2020 edition. The aim of the competition is to provide the WCO members with a means to showcase their administration’s history, activities and successes.

The winning photo shows a Customs officer in uniform alongside his faithful friend, ready to start the day despite the risks posed by the spread of Covid-19.
